Russian checkers/Draughts (Shashki or Russian shashki) is the most popular type of draughts played in Russia, Eastern Europe and Israel. The goal of the game is to capture all the opponent’s pieces or prevent him to make a move.

Game Instructions: Russian Draughts

- The King can move diagonally to any free square, backward or forward.
- If after capturing an enemy’s piece you still have an allowed a jumps move then you must continue the jump sequence (jump is mandatory).
- The jump with a simple piece is done both forward and backward.
